Hungary: the United States ambassador “persona non grata” to the government of Viktor Orban

In Budapest, the American ambassador, David Pressmann, in office since last September, is not welcome. He is the new pet peeve of the media close to power.

This offensive is explained firstly because of his personality. David Pressman is married to a man. He arrived in Budapest with her husband and their two children. However, the ultra-conservative government of Viktor Orban pursues a policy hostile to LGBT+ people .

According to Viktor Orban’s party, which has a lot in common with the Republicans in the United States, Hungary is threatened by leftist forces who want to impose gender ideology on society. The new American ambassador, appointed by the Democrats, therefore by the American left, perfectly embodies this “plot”.

Ambassador accused of interference

The diplomat was even nicknamed “ Madame Ambassador ” on a talk show . But it’s not just personal attacks. David Pressman is also accused of interference in Hungarian politics, since after meeting Hungarian magistrates opposed to the government, the ambassador was immediately singled out. He replied that it was rather Viktor Orban who interfered in American politics. He recalled that last summer, three months before the midterm elections in the United States, Viktor Orban went to Texas to campaign with the Republican candidates.
